Cabinet Secretary for Cooperatives and MSME Development Simon Chelugui said that the Hustler Fund loan limit would be looked at again the following week.


Speaking to Hustlers during a Christmas party he threw at his Kisanana, Baringo County residence, CS Chelugui gave them the assurance that the limitations will be revisited at the end of the month.


But he said that the evaluation will be based on the borrower's history of timely repayment.


"People who accepted the money but didn't pay may get lost in the process. It's possible that's where their voyage ends "On Tuesday, he said.


So far, according to CS Chelugui, progress has been excellent.A total of Sh11.3 billion had been distributed as of Tuesday morning, and Sh4.1 billion, or 37%, had been repaid.


President William Ruto announced the Financial Inclusion Fund on November 30. Since then, 17.2 million Kenyans have signed up and are now able to use the fund.


A total of 20 million transactions have resulted in the savings account reaching Sh570 million so far. 4 million Kenyans in total.
